Erm. . . for the 07' I don't think there are any CARB Approved CAI system yet. I have yet to find one. BTW, i've joined up with the Nor Cal Scikotics. Weapon-R has the SRI, But still no CARB Sticker on it. Hmm . . I've been wanting to put in a CAI for my car, and the ONLY option I THINK I have is the actual TRD CAI, which costs an arm and a leg for me. I don't wanna pay that much and perform less than the Injen CAI. Hey guys, let me know if you DO know a manufacturer with a CAI that I can install in CA!! CA is a pain in the ass.

What you are talking about is heatsoak. It is just a build up of heat on the internal strata of surfaces, whether or not, they are metal, plastic, glass, wood, etc. Steel retains heat more than aluminum with copper transferring heat the best. Copper corrodes too easily, so aluminum being the best compromise.
If heatsoak is a problem you can just wrap your intake piping with Thermotec
